Sercel holds 120 US patents across 48 technology areas, rank #3,143 of 50,000 tracked assignees.
Sercel, Inc has been granted 120 US utility patents between 2015 and 2025, placing Sercel, Inc at rank #3,143 across all assignees tracked by PlainPatent. This portfolio spans 48 distinct Cooperative Patent Classification (CPC) subclasses, averaging 16.7 claims per patent with primary concentration in G01V (GEOPHYSICS; GRAVITATIONAL MEASUREMENTS; DETECTING MASSES OR OBJECTS; TAGS). Filing cadence tells the strategic story. Between 2020 and 2025 the company received 42 grants, compared with 78 in the 2015–2019 window, a -46% shift in five-year velocity. A cooling filing rate may reflect portfolio consolidation, shifting priorities, or reduced R&D throughput. Teal-shaded recent years (2020–present) versus the 2015–2019 baseline. Full figures in the table below.
| Year | Patents Granted | Share of Period |
|---|---|---|
| 2015 | 6 | 5.0% |
| 2016 | 25 | 20.8% |
| 2017 | 24 | 20.0% |
| 2018 | 13 | 10.8% |
| 2019 | 10 | 8.3% |
| 2020 | 6 | 5.0% |
| 2021 | 3 | 2.5% |
| 2022 | 8 | 6.7% |
| 2023 | 11 | 9.2% |
| 2024 | 7 | 5.8% |
| 2025 | 7 | 5.8% |
